What's The Definition Of Pipra?
[n] type genus of the Pipridae containing the typical manakins
Synonyms | Synonyms for Pipra: genus Pipra Related Terms | Find terms related to Pipra: See Also | bird genus | family Pipridae | manakin | Pipridae Pipra In Webster's Dictionary \Pi"pra\, n.; pl. {Pipras}. [NL., fr. Gr. ? a woodpecker.]
(Zo["o]l.)
Any one of numerous species of small clamatorial birds
belonging to {Pipra} and allied genera, of the family
{Piprid[ae]}. The male is usually glossy black, varied with
scarlet, yellow, or sky blue. They chiefly inhabit South
America.
